The Cloud Networking SRE team is part of Akamai's Infrastructure Engineering & Operations organization. We design, deploy, and manage the reliability of Akamai's core cloud networking products. These products are foundational to the Akamai Cloud Compute platform, serving customer workloads across dozens of global regions. In this role, you'll own the operational reliability of two generations of load balancing infrastructure. You'll build and maintain observability frameworks, lead incident response for complex multiservice failures, and drive safe deployment practices across global rollouts. You'll work closely with cross-functional teams to shape how the NB/NLB stack evolves operationally.

Requirements

  • 8+ years of experience in SRE, infrastructure engineering, or platform engineering, working with large-scale distributed systems
  • Demonstrate deep expertise with Linux networking fundamentals and diagnosing at the packet level using tcpdump, netstat, and similar tools
  • Have hands-on experience with L4/L7 load balancing technologies covering configuration, health checking, high availability, and failure modes at scale
  • Show a track record of defining SLO/SLI frameworks, building observability platforms from scratch, and running incident management processes at scale
  • Demonstrate expertise in Kubernetes and containerization at scale including workload scheduling, networking, resource management, and operating stateful or network-intensive workloads in a cluster environment
  • Build automation and tooling using Python or Go, with infrastructure-as-code experience (SaltStack, Ansible, or Terraform) and deployment safety instincts

Responsibilities

  • Owning the SRE infrastructure lifecycle from design reviews and pre-rollout readiness assessments through production sign-off and ongoing reliability management
  • Designing and implementing frameworks that reflect customer experience for load balancing services and driving action when error budgets are at risk
  • Building and maintaining observability pipelines from load-balancing components and system-level sources to dashboards that enable rapid incident triage
  • Leading technical incident response for complex NB/NLB failures, acting as the technical commander and driving root cause analysis and preventive follow-through
  • Developing and automating safe deployment workflows for phased releases, including bake-period monitoring, feature flag management, and validation across global datacenter rollouts
  • Reviewing design documents, product-requirement documents and producing actionable SRE input on operational risks, capacity implications, Day-2 concerns, and product strategy gaps
  • Building automation and tooling using Python or Go that reduces operational toil and improves team-wide operational capability
